#include <iostream>
#include <fstream>
using namespace std;
int main()
{
fstream dane("napis.txt", ios::in);
string szukane = "lorem", wiersz = "";
int liczba_slow = 0;
while (getline(dane, wiersz))
{
cout << wiersz << endl;
size_t nastepny = 0;
int liczba_slow_wiersz = 0;
while(true)
{
size_t pozycja = wiersz.find(szukane, nastepny);
if (pozycja != string::npos)
{
liczba_slow_wiersz++;
nastepny = pozycja + 1;
} else
break;
}
liczba_slow += liczba_slow_wiersz;
cout << "Slowo " << szukane << " wystapilo w wierszu " << liczba_slow_wiersz << endl << endl;
}
cout << "Slowo " << szukane << " wystapilo " << liczba_slow;
return 0;
}
lorem ipsum dolor sit amet lorem consectetur adipiscing elit
sed do eiusmod tempor lorem incididunt ut labore et dolore
magna aliqua lorem ut enim ad minim lorem veniam, quis lorem
exercitation ullamco laboris nisi ut aliquip ex ea
commodo consequat duis aute irure dolor in reprehenderit
in voluptate velit esse cillum dolore eu fugiat nulla
pariatur excepteur sint occaecat cupidatat non proident
sunt in culpa qui officia deserunt lorem anim id est laborum.